NAME

Q_XQUOTARM - free disk space taken by disk quotas

LIBRARY

Standard C library (libc-lc)

SYNOPSIS

#include <xfs/xqm.h>      /* See quotactl(2) */
#include <sys/quota.h>
int quotactl(QCMD(Q_XQUOTARM, type), const char *_Nullable special, 0,
             caddr_t addr);
#include <xfs/xqm.h>      /* See quotactl_fd(2) */
#include <sys/syscall.h>  /* Definition of SYS_* constants */
#include <unistd.h>
int syscall(SYS_quotactl_fd, int fd, QCMD(Q_XQUOTARM, type), 0,
            unsigned int *addr);

DESCRIPTION

Free the disk space taken by disk quotas.

The addr argument should be a pointer to an unsigned int value containing flags (the same as in .d_flags field of the fs_disk_quota(2type) structure) which identify what types of quota should be removed.

Quotas must have already been turned off.

HISTORY

Buggy until Linux 3.16.

CAVEATS

The quota type argument is ignored, but should remain valid in order to pass preliminary quotactl syscall handler checks.
